| Episode narrativeepisode_narrative | A very moist air mass in combination with light winds fields and a weak land breeze boundary, resulted in favorable conditions for waterspout formation across the Atlantic Coastal Waters. |
| Event narrativeevent_narrative | The Tybee Island Ocean Rescue Squad reported a waterspout 3 miles east of the northern end of Tybee Island, Georgia. |
